Чим відрізняються ф'ючерсні та спотові ринки криптовалют
Understanding the fundamental differences between spot and futures markets is essential before you start trading with automated crypto trading bots. Each market type requires different approaches, risk considerations, and bot configurations.
- Spot markets: You buy and sell the underlying asset directly, such as BTC or ETH, for immediate delivery and settlement. Crypto trading on spot markets involves no leverage exposure and no funding payment obligations. Your maximum loss is limited to your invested capital.
- Futures markets: You trade contracts that track the price of the underlying asset rather than owning the asset itself. Crypto futures include perpetual swaps with no expiration date and dated futures contracts that settle at specific times. You can utilize leverage to amplify exposure, choose between cross or isolated margin modes for risk management, and you may pay or receive funding rates in perpetual contracts depending on market conditions.
Because leverage magnifies both potential returns and potential losses significantly, trading futures demands strict application of risk management tools, disciplined trading strategies, and a clear predetermined plan for trade exits. Futures grid bots, trend-following bots, and dca bots help structure this discipline systematically so you can maintain trading efficiency even during the most volatile markets.
Additional distinctions between these markets include settlement mechanisms, margin requirements, and position management complexity. Futures traders must monitor maintenance margin levels to avoid liquidation, track funding rate schedules that occur every 8 hours on most exchanges, and understand the implications of contract specifications including tick sizes and position limits. These factors directly influence bot configuration and strategy selection.

Бот для торгівлі на ф'ючерсних ринках
A futures grid trading bot is a specialized grid bot that places a structured lattice of buy and sell orders around a mid-price at preset intervals. In range-bound market conditions where price oscillates within defined boundaries, grid trading aims to capture small, repeated profits as price moves between grid levels. Futures grid bots can utilize leverage and operate on both USDT-margined and coin-margined perpetual contracts. You can run futures grid trading bots with isolated margin mode for better risk containment, limiting potential losses to the margin allocated to that specific position. These bots have gained popularity because they offer a clearly structured trading process and remain relatively easy to configure, making them particularly suitable for traders who prefer automated strategies that do not require constant signal generation or market analysis.
Advanced grid implementations include dynamic grid spacing that adjusts based on volatility measurements, asymmetric grids that place more orders on one side based on directional bias, and trailing grid mechanisms that relocate the entire grid structure as price trends. Understanding these variations helps traders select configurations appropriate for specific market conditions.
Ф'ючерсний бот DCA
A dca futures bot applies dollar cost averaging logic to futures positions systematically. Instead of entering a full position at a single price point, the bot scales into trades at preset intervals or price steps, building the position gradually. DCA strategies effectively reduce the impact of timing risk when entering volatile markets by averaging the entry price across multiple levels. DCA bots are typically paired with clear exit rules including take-profit targets and stop-loss levels. During trending markets, a dca futures bot smooths entries while providing a structured path to partial exits as price reaches predefined profit thresholds.
Modern DCA implementations incorporate safety order multipliers that increase position size at deeper price levels, configurable deviation percentages between orders, and maximum position limits that prevent overexposure. These parameters require careful calibration based on historical volatility analysis and available capital.

Мережева торгівля для ринків діапазону
Grid trading places layered buy and sell orders at preset intervals above and below the current market price. In futures markets, this strategy can employ leverage while keeping individual positions small and overall risk controlled. Futures grid trading bots should define a price band establishing upper and lower boundaries, grid density determining spacing between orders, order size per grid level, plus stop-loss and take-profit logic. When market volatility exhibits mean-reverting characteristics, a futures grid trading bot harvests small repeated profits from price oscillations. When a breakout occurs, risk management tools become essential to limit drawdowns.
Effective grid trading requires understanding the relationship between grid spacing, expected volatility, and profit per grid trade. Tighter grids generate more frequent but smaller profits, while wider grids capture larger moves but execute less frequently. The optimal configuration depends on transaction costs, typical price range, and available capital for margin requirements.

Ставка фінансування та базові стратегії
Perpetual futures utilize funding rates to anchor contract prices close to spot prices. Some automated strategies seek to capture funding payments while hedging underlying price exposure. Basis strategies might pair spot holdings with short futures positions or rotate between exchanges offering favorable funding rates. These approaches require robust monitoring of exchange fees, funding schedules, and margin impact on overall positions.

Якість виконання та мікроструктура ринку
Trading efficiency depends heavily on execution quality. You can improve results by selecting supported exchanges with deep order books, competitive fees, and fast matching engines. Consider these factors:
- Maker versus taker: Grid bots typically post maker orders to reduce taker fees. Momentum bots often accept taker fees in exchange for immediate execution certainty.
- Slippage and spreads: Thin markets increase slippage costs. Use multiple exchanges to route orders to the best available venue.
- Затримка та стабільність: Надійні потоки обміну apis та WebSocket зменшують кількість пропущених сигналів та фантомних заповнень.
- Funding and fees: Net returns depend on funding rates, maker/taker fee structures, and discounts available through VIP tiers or an affiliate program.
Understanding order book dynamics becomes increasingly important as position sizes grow. Large orders can move markets, creating slippage that erodes strategy profitability. Smart order routing algorithms that split orders across time or across venues help minimize market impact for larger positions.
Дані, сигнали та оптимізація
Automated trading bots rely on data quality and robust testing methodologies. Use historical data to backtest trading rules and refine parameters systematically. Combine technical indicators with market structure metrics like open interest, funding rates, and order book depth for more comprehensive analysis. Trading signals can originate from your own models, third-party providers, or a copy trading marketplace. When adopting signals from other platforms or other traders, verify methodology, win-loss ratios, drawdown statistics, and risk-adjusted returns thoroughly. Always remember that past performance may not reflect future outcomes.
Parameter optimization requires careful attention to overfitting risks. Strategies that perform exceptionally well on historical data may fail in live trading if parameters were tuned too precisely to past conditions. Techniques like walk-forward analysis, out-of-sample testing, and Monte Carlo simulation help validate strategy robustness and reduce overfitting risks.

Що таке правило 80% в торгівлі ф'ючерсами?
The 80% rule is a market profile concept stating that if price re-enters a prior value area, there is a high probability it will traverse that value area completely. While some traders apply this idea in futures trading to frame mean-reversion or breakout pullback setups, it is not a guarantee of price behavior. For automated crypto trading, you can encode rules that trigger entries when price returns to a value area and exits when the area is traversed, combined with stop-loss protection. As with any trading concept, validate it with historical data and paper trading, apply strict risk management, and adjust for current market conditions and volatility levels.
How much capital do I need to start futures bot trading?
The minimum capital required for futures bot trading varies depending on the exchange, the trading strategy employed, and your risk management preferences. Most major exchanges allow futures trading with as little as $10-50 USD, though practical considerations suggest starting with $100-500 minimum for meaningful diversification and proper position sizing. Grid trading bots typically require more capital than simple dca bots because they need to place multiple orders across price levels simultaneously. Consider exchange minimum order sizes, margin requirements for your chosen leverage, and the need to withstand normal drawdowns without liquidation. Starting with conservative capital and scaling up as you verify strategy performance remains the prudent approach.
